Based on existing data for local elections 2014, Central Election Commission prepared gender statistics. Document reflects a balance between men and women candidates for Mayor and Gamgebeli positions, as well as electoral subjects in party lists. Statistics were also calculated regarding majority system candidates registered by initiative groups and parties/blocks. Concerning gender balance in total electoral roll, according to data of May 1 - 1,866,514 from 3,472,772 voters are female, and others are male.
Statistics include gender composition of election administration of CEC, as well as regional and district election commissions.
Gender statistics:
Gender balance of Tbilisi mayoral candidates Total: 14 – 12 men and 2 women
Gender balance of registered mayoral candidates in self-governing cities (in total 11 self-governing cities except Tbilisi) Total: 73 – 65 men and 8 women
Gender balance of registered candidates for Gamgebeli of self-governing communities (except Tbilisi) Total: 261– 251 men and 10 women
Candidates registered by election subjects’ party-lists (Tbilisi) Total: 1 129– 702 men and 427 women
Gender composition of candidates registered by parties/blocks for majority system elections (Tbilisi) Total: 308– 242 men and 66 women
Gender composition of candidates registered by parties/blocks for majority system elections (except Tbilisi) Total: 5 707– 4861 men and 846 women
Gender composition of candidates registered by initiative groups for majority system elections (Tbilisi) Total: 5 – 5 men and 0 women
Gender composition of candidates registered by initiative groups for majority system elections (except Tbilisi) Total: 897 – 796 men and 101 women
Gender composition of total electoral roll Total: 3 472 772 –1606 258 men and 1 866 514 women
